DELTA & GAMMA CAPITAL MANAGEMENT LLC is an SEC-registered investment adviser in NEW YORK, NY. The firm manages approximately $11 million in regulatory assets, $8 million on a discretionary basis. It has 1 employee and 1 investment adviser.
